太陽能發電系統之微型逆變器(Micro Inverter) 產業優勢及行銷策略

Micro Inverter solar power system of industrial advantages and marketing strategy

指導教授 : 郭瑞祥 博士
共同指導教授 : 陳俊忠 博士

摘要


本研究之主要目的在於研究太陽能潛力產品的Micro inverter(微型逆變器),它在太陽能產業鏈中的定位及位置。台灣廠商的技術優勢適合設計製造集多項優點於一身的Micro inverter (微型逆變器),是未來太陽能產品的主流明星產品。未來勢必會打敗目前傳統的PV String Inverter(串列逆變器),取代掉目前所有家用市場(20KW以下)及一般商用市場(100KW)。又因為它具有極佳的安全性低壓直流40伏特(DC40V),對於人畜不會造成傷害;更高的發電效率(遮蔭補償);更精準的監控系統(可以監控每一片太陽能面板的發電狀況);提供快速的安裝時間及成本(以一般家庭使用者10K為例,可以節省60%的安裝時間;以及節省10%的安裝成本);更有長達25年的產品壽命且免保養及長達25年的保固,其壽命更是達到傳統PV String Inverter(串列逆變器)4倍的壽命。再加上具有更先進的雲端系統結合大數據(big data)功能,可以輕易了解每座太陽能發電廠的狀況,提供更精準的數據給EPC (Engineering,Procurement,and Construction)公司作為賣電拆帳的依據,達到獲利極大化風險極小化的理想,節省後續龐大的維修成本。至於為什麼使用Micro inverter有這麼多的好處,銷售卻沒有快速爆炸性的成長呢?又為什麼目前全球70%的銷售量在北美市場呢?其他國家又為何遲遲無法快速導入優質的Micro inverter(微型逆變器)呢?有沒有新的商業模式(Business model)可以克服新產品成長緩慢的問題呢?如何運用創新的模式去增加成長、進行研究及分析。最後,運用Micro inverter(微型逆變器)的分散式電網的優勢進行下個階段的社區微電網(Micro Grid)加電力儲能系統(Electronic Storage System)的高效可靠的社區不斷電智慧電網系統,進而帶動太陽能產業供應鏈的蓬勃發展。 先從未來能源需求,到太陽能漸漸成為主力能源開始探討,再研究太陽能上中下游的產業型態,進而找出適合公司切入的下游產業,運用SWOT分析找出適合公司的產品Micro inverter。再依據Micro inverter的優勢結合週邊產品成為Micro PV kit增加營收,使事業部增加營收。成為一個漸漸壯大的綠能公司。除了理論與實際交互驗證外,也運用現有公司的資源及技術資料進行產業分析;技術門檻找出差異化的競爭策略,結合台大學習的各種國際企業的管理手法,運用既有的專業知識創新的產品組合及運用差異化的行銷策略及商業模式達成全球Micro inverter的市占率20%前三強的終極目標。促進全球再生能源的市占率快速提升,達成全球充滿潔淨再生能源的非核家園。

並列摘要


NAME: Li-Hsiang ADVISOR: Ruey-Shan Guo, Ph.D., Chun-Chung Chen, Ph.D. TITLE: Micro Inverter solar power system of industrial advantages and marketing strategy The main purpose of this research is to study the potential of solar energy products Micro inverter. It positioning and position in the solar industry chain The Taiwan manufacturers of technology for the design and manufacture of a number of advantages in a Micro inverter, solar energy is the future mainstream star products product. It will replace all current out of the resendential market (20KW or less) and general commercial market (100KW), because it has an excellent safety low voltage DC40V. It will not cause harm to humans and animals; Due to the Micro inverter system can output higher power generation efficiency when the shading compensation. It can monitor power status of each piece of the solar panel. It can provide more accurate information for customar. Installation costs can provide fast installation time and lower. General home users 10K for example, can save 60% installation time and save 10% of the installation costs. More than 25 years of product life and maintenance-free and 25-year warranty, their life is very traditional PV String Inverter4 times of life. It will coupled with a more advanced system combines a large cloud data (big data) function, you can easily understand the status of each block solar power plant to provide more accurate data to EPC. More information can be used as its profit-based selling electricity to achieve profit maximization over risk minimization, saving the follow-up to the huge repair costs. As to why the use of Micro inverter has so many benefits, but there are no quick explosive sales growth it? Why the current 90% of global sales in the North American market? In other countries and why they could not quickly import high quality Micro inverter it? Do you new business model can overcome the problem of slow new product to grow up? How innovative models to increase growth, conducting research and analysis? Finally, the advantages of using Micro inverter (micro-inverters) distributed grid for the next phase of community micro-grid plus electricity storage system highly efficient and reliable UPS smart grid community, thereby bringing booming solar industry supply chain. Start with the future energy needs, and gradually to the main solar energy, solar energy and then research on the middle and lower reaches of the industry patterns, and then find the appropriate company cut into the downstream industries using SWOT analysis to identify for the company to find the product Micro inverter. It will base on the advantages of Micro inverter combination of peripheral products become Micro PV kit to increase revenue, so division increased revenue. Gradually become a green energy company to grow. Here in addition to theoretical and practical cross-validation, and use of existing resources and information Technology Company for industrial analysis; the use of high technology threshold to identify differences in the competitive strategy. Then combined with National Taiwan University study international business management practices, the use of existing expertise in innovative product portfolio and the use of differentiated marketing strategies and business models to reach a 20% market share of the top three global Micro inverter ultimate goal. Finally, the promotion of renewable energy worldwide market share quickly upgrade, reached the ultimate goal of global nuclear-free homeland filled with clean renewable energy.
